Goods Inward
- All stock items delivered must be processed with in an 8HR shift
- Discrepancies or missing documentation must be reported to the relevant sections
- Vehicle check must take place before deliveries are off loaded and any issues must be reported to the warehouse supervisor/manager
- Completion of all relevant documentation and cross referencing with the supplier documentation. Reporting any discrepancies
- Booking in of stock on line 200 and the generation of the GRN labels
- Ensure that all deliveries are on the correct pallets for storage in the warehouse locations also the application of the GRN labels to the outer packaging
- Locating of stock into the correct storage areas and the sage transactions and application of pallet sheets
